Output 40bd923fc23e79a6e1c84082f9ceeca2128495695434efde3ba6a7eb869257eb:2

value
6387545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746f74d757330188c62d1441777d61f544045fcc OP_EQUAL
address
3CJfpvW8w2qRDKsJyPS6YeD8eLyErUppNa
transaction
40bd923fc23e79a6e1c84082f9ceeca2128495695434efde3ba6a7eb869257eb
confirmations
298373
spent
true